The No. 22 Syracuse University Orange (6-5, 3-4 ACC) and Boston College Eagles (3-8, 2-5 ACC) face off Saturday at Alumni Stadium for their regular season finales. The Orange are 10.5-point favorites, and the total is 47.

Syracuse is coming off a 45-35 loss to Wake Forest at Truist Field last Saturday, their fifth consecutive defeat. Garrett Shrader was 17 of 31 for 324 yards with a touchdown and an interception. Sean Tucker ran 16 times for 106 yards and two touchdowns. Oronde Gadsden II caught six passes for 85 yards.

Boston College lost 44-0 to No. 18 Notre Dame at Notre Dame Stadium last Saturday. Emmett Morehead threw for 117 yards and three interceptions. Alex Broome carried seven times for 25 yards. Zay Flowers caught three receptions for 46 yards.

HEAD-TO-HEAD

The Orange won the only game between the teams last season, a 21-6 victory in October. Sean Tucker had a rushing touchdown for Syracuse.

TALE OF THE TAPE

The Orange are averaging 28.0 points per game for the season, 71st in FBS, and they are facing an Eagles defense that has surrendered 30.2 PPG (104th). Meanwhile, Boston College has scored 17.3 points a game this season, 125th in the nation, and Syracuse is allowing 22.6 PPG (37th).

The Orange rank 84th in the country in passing yards per game (218.2) and 80th in rushing (141.5), while the Eagles are 39th in passing yards allowed per game (204.5) and 91st against the run (168.3).

Boston College has been the country’s least successful rushing team, averaging 62.3 yards per game, while ranking 48th in passing yards (246.6). The Orange are allowing 183.0 passing yards (13th) and 155.6 rushing yards per game (77th).

TOP PERFORMERS

Through 10 games, Garrett Shrader has thrown for 15 touchdowns (6 INT) and 202.5 yards per game to lead Syracuse in passing. In three away games this season, he has five TDs (2 INT) and an average of 261.0 yards passing.

Sean Tucker leads the team in rushing with an average of 85.0 yards a game over 11 games. He has nine touchdowns on the ground and two through the air. Oronde Gadsden II is the Orange’s leading receiver with 78.5 yards a game and six TDs.

Phil Jurkovec has 11 passing touchdowns (8 INT) with 213.9 yards per game through eight games to lead Boston College. In four home games this season, he has thrown for eight TDs (3 INT) and an average of 273.8 yards.

Pat Garwo III has been the home team’s leading performer on the ground, averaging 29.1 yards a game through 11 games. He has two touchdowns. Zay Flowers has been the primary target in the Eagles’ aerial attack. He has 10 touchdowns and an 87.9 yard per game average through 11 appearances.
